Roll of Honour Citation

Shot and killed when she and a colleague responded to a personal attack alarm.

Shot in the chest from point-blank range when she and a colleague responded to a personal attack alarm at a travel agency in Morley Street, Bradford. As they arrived the officers were confronted by three armed robbers leaving the premises, one of whom shot both officers, killing PC Beshenivsky and wounding her colleague.

Sharon had been appointed as a Constable in the West Yorkshire Police on 7 February 2005, following nearly two years service as a Community Support Officer; she joined a patrol team at Bradford South Division in May.

She is survived by her husband, two sons and her daughter who was four years old that day, her stepdaughter and stepson.
